My friend Andy
Where are you?
Why after all these years
Do you not want to be in touch?

Is it because you think
I have become ‘someone’
And you not

Believe me
I am a ‘nobody’ in the eyes of the world

Please let us speak again
Before one of us dies

We were such good friends
So many years

The laughter the life we shared
The memories only we have
Of childhood of youth
Of so many people we knew

You were kind to my mother
In her last years
When I was far away

We were friends so long
I miss you

Can’t we just talk and laugh together again
As we did for so many years
